So I ended up making my own mask, I think it came out pretty good.





I know that the eyebrows are a little too curvy, but oh well.

Heres me wearing it:



I sketched out everything with a pencil like people had said to do. I used sharpie for the eyebrows and acrylic paint for the eyes, mouth and the masks edge/outline. It took me something like 3 hours to complete. It was totally worth it though!

Might I ask where you located the mask and what it (the mask) is called?

I want...


I bought my mask from a store called A.C. Moore. It's like Michael's basically. The product name is : "Mask-it" by A company called "Midwest Design" And the mask's model type is: Male, 8.5" (21.6CM). You obviously have to paint it your self, so use acrylic paint.
